Traditional Culture Encyclopedia - Traditional virtues - What are the methods of machine learning?
What are the methods of machine learning?
Supervised learning: Supervised learning is one of the most commonly used methods in machine learning. In supervised learning, the system will be given a set of sample data with known input and output, and the system needs to learn a function so that the function can predict the correct output according to the given input.
Unsupervised learning: Unsupervised learning is another common method in machine learning. In unsupervised learning, the system only has input data and no output data. The system needs to learn a function that can automatically classify the input data.
Semi-supervised learning: Semi-supervised learning is a method of mixed supervised learning and unsupervised learning. In semi-supervised learning, the system will be given some known input and output sample data and some unknown input data. The system needs to learn a function by using known sample data, so that the function can predict the correct output according to unknown input data.
Reinforcement learning: Reinforcement learning is a learning method based on environment and feedback, and the system learns the optimal strategy through constant interaction.
Clustering: Clustering is an unsupervised learning method in machine learning. Its purpose is to divide data into different groups, so as to maximize the data similarity within groups and minimize the data similarity between groups.
Dimension reduction: Dimension reduction is an unsupervised learning method in machine learning. Its purpose is to reduce the dimension of data and make it easier to analyze.
Deep learning: Deep learning is a learning method based on neural network in machine learning, which simulates human brain to learn by constructing multi-layer neural network. Deep learning is widely used in computer vision, speech recognition, natural language processing and other fields.
Recurrent neural network: Recurrent neural network is a special deep learning method, which recursively processes sequence data and is widely used in natural language processing, speech recognition and other fields.
Bayesian learning: Bayesian learning is a learning method based on probability theory and statistics, learning and forecasting through Bayesian theorem.
Statistical learning method: Statistical learning method is a machine learning method based on statistical theory, which learns and predicts through statistical model and optimization algorithm. Include linear regression, logistic regression, naive Bayes, etc.
These methods have their own characteristics and scope of application. In practical application, we should choose the appropriate method according to the specific situation of the problem.
- Previous article:Description of New Chinese Design Concept
- Next article:Review of a New Book on the History of Chinese Zen Buddhism
- Related articles
- Boshan Cuisine of Boshan Cuisine
- Jiangsu Xuzhou specialty
- What are the types and uses of paint paint knowledge introduction
- What are the basic strokes?
- How to see the extravagant wind of the wedding People's Daily Online
- What are the four major festivals in China?
- Is Suzhou Embroidery the same as Tin Embroidery?
- What are the characteristics of the bus body structure with full load?
- What is the largest existing royal garden in China?
- What is the role of Shanxi mature vinegar in catching ice in winter and drying it in summer?